The house at 501 East Rosemary Street was originally built to be the rectory for Chapel of the Cross. Kit houses like this one were popular in the early 20th century and were purchased by mail order. The lumber for these houses, along with the windows and doors, was delivered by rail and the house was constructed on site. The current owners, Katherine and Vincent Kopp, recently undertook a major renovation of the home.
